Abstract
We study by quantum Monte Carlo simulations the phase diagram of lattice hard-core bosons with nearest-neighbor repulsive interactions, in the presence of a superlattice of adsorption sites. For a moderate adsorption strength, the system forms crystal phases registered with the adsorption lattice; a “supersolid” phase exists, on both the vacancy and interstitial sides, whereas at commensuration, the superfluid density vanishes. The possible relevance of these results to experiments on films adsorbed on graphite is discussed.
